NEW: Rubio closes a State Dept. office that counters disinfo by China, Russia and Iran. He is firing about 40 employees. I’m told the person organizing it is Darren Beattie — fired from the first Trump White House for giving a speech to white nationalists. Story: www.nytimes.com/2025/04/16/u...
Trump Aides Close State Dept. Office on Foreign Disinformation
Secretary of State Marco Rubio put about 40 employees on leave who had tracked disinformation by China, Russia, Iran and terrorist groups.

"I want to keep boycotting Amazon, but I also want to support indie authors. How do I do that?"

Many indie authors have their books on Barnes & Noble & Kobo! There are also places like Smashwords & Campfire that are almost all indie books! Itchio now has a THRIVING LGBTQ Indie Book Scene.
